Output 7d60a320bb006f60e70c1de11da98b32ca11df0358ec9f7e84c426ffd9a74e16:0

value
856965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afdf82c3870153735206a1d100903512937884f7 OP_EQUAL
address
3Hiwvv7A4RfZv9VmwnUcqcAMQ9tnrNUp36
transaction
7d60a320bb006f60e70c1de11da98b32ca11df0358ec9f7e84c426ffd9a74e16
spent
true